What's The Definition Of Whispering campaign?

whispering campaign in American English
the organized dissemination of defamatory rumors by word of mouth, intended to discredit a political candidate, group, cause, etc.
the organized spreading of insinuations or rumors to destroy the reputation of a person, organization, etc

whispering campaign in British English
noun: the organized diffusion by word of mouth of defamatory rumours designed to discredit a person, group, etc
